I see the Tascam M-520 has 4 shorting PINS (not referring to the 2-pin shorting bars) that short out the RCA jack wherever they are inserted.

Scanned the manual and many of the online pages here, but I have not found what the designated locations are for inserting them, or if they are really needed. I did see a reference to the phono jacks, but that only accounts for two of them.

Any high level gain stage that does not have anything plugged into it might as well have shorted input so as not to pick up noise or Radio Stations. Phono might be one place and then maybe Buss SUB in might be another- apply where the input not used will give any noise trouble but never any output RCA.
Might also be used at Instrument input. Look online for pictures of the rear panel as they may still be in there if the user never had to remove them.
 
Well, I kept digging (being I was already in a rabbit hole), and I discovered a pic in the manual where I could see the shorting pins inserted. That was once I copied it into PhotoShop and enlarged it.

The pins are on "INST IN" on channels 1 & 2, and "PHONO" (in) on channels 3 & 4.
